Expand description

Trait implemented by types that can visit all Operator variants.

Required Associated Types

The result type of the visitor.

Required Methods

Provided Methods

Visits the Operator op using the given offset.

Note

This is a convenience method that is intended for non-performance critical use cases. For performance critical implementations users are recommended to directly use the respective visit methods or implement VisitOperator on their own.
